Noel Anthony Hogan (Moyross, Limerick, 25 de diciembre de 1971) es un músico irlandés, más conocido por ser el guitarrista y coescritor de las canciones del grupo de rock alternativo The Cranberries . Carrera. The Cranberries. Noel Hogan formó el grupo The Cranberries en el año 1989 junto a su hermano Mike, Fergal Lawler y Niall Quinn.

En 1989 varios jóvenes se unieron con el propósito de formar un grupo: Noel Hogan (Limerick, 25 de diciembre de 1971), a la guitarra eléctrica, su hermano Mike Hogan (Limerick, 29 de abril de 1973), al bajo eléctrico, Fergal Lawler (Limerick, 4 de marzo de 1971), a la batería y Niall Quinn a la voz.
